付録A.4 コード変換をするときの注意事項
-
入力データの先頭がKEISコードで始まる場合は,全角開始コード(0x0A42)を付けてください。
-
外字マッピングテーブルが存在しない場合は,外字コードはスペースに変換します。外字マッピングテーブルの詳細については,マニュアル「CommuniNet Version 3」を参照してください。
-
EBCDIKコード,EBCDICコード,またはKEISコードから,JISコードまたはシフトJISコードへの変換中に,変換表に存在しないコードを検出した場合は,次のように変換します。
-
dc_clt_code_convert関数またはdc_clt_codeconv_exec関数の引数flagsにDCCLT_CNV_INVSPCを指定した場合,0x0A直後の1バイトが0x41または0x42以外のときは,0x0Aを該当するコードに変換します。
-
全角モードでの変換中に0x00〜0x40の半角コードを検出した場合,該当する1バイトコードに変換します。
-